Why 18/2 Stranded Wire Is Necessary

I find 18/2 stranded wire necessary because it gives me the right balance of flexibility and reliability for many low-voltage projects. The stranded design makes it easier for me to route the wire through tight spaces, around corners, and into equipment without worrying as much about breakage from bending. That flexibility has saved me time and frustration during installation.

I also prefer 18/2 wire because it is a practical choice for connecting devices that do not need heavy power, such as speakers, thermostats, doorbells, and other control systems. In my experience, the 18-gauge size is strong enough for many everyday applications, while the two conductors make simple positive-and-negative wiring straightforward and organized.

Another reason I rely on it is durability. Since the wire is made of many small strands instead of one solid core, it handles movement and vibration better. For me, that means fewer worries about cracks or failures over time, especially in setups where the wire may be adjusted, handled, or moved more often.

My Buying Guides on 18 2 Stranded Wire

What I Look for in 18 2 Stranded Wire

When I shop for 18 2 stranded wire, the first thing I check is the wire gauge and strand count. I want to make sure it is truly 18 AWG with two conductors, since that is the standard I usually need for low-voltage and general electrical projects. I also look at whether the wire is stranded, because I prefer it for flexibility and easier handling compared to solid wire.

Why I Prefer Stranded Over Solid Wire

In my experience, stranded wire bends more easily and holds up better in applications where the wire may move or need to be routed through tight spaces. I find it especially useful for speakers, alarms, lighting, and other projects where flexibility matters. If I know the wire will stay fixed in one place, I may still consider solid wire, but for most of my jobs, stranded is my choice.

Insulation Type Matters to Me

I always pay attention to the insulation material. Some 18 2 stranded wires come with PVC insulation, while others may be rated for higher temperature or outdoor use. I choose the insulation based on where I plan to use it. For indoor work, standard insulation is often enough. For harsher environments, I look for wire that is rated for heat, moisture, or direct burial if needed.

Length and Roll Size I Consider

Before I buy, I estimate how much wire I actually need. I have learned that buying too little can delay a project, while buying too much can waste money. I usually compare spool sizes and choose one that gives me a little extra room for mistakes, routing, and future adjustments.

Voltage and Application Ratings I Check

I never skip checking the wire’s rating. Even though 18 2 stranded wire is commonly used for low-voltage applications, I still verify that it matches my project requirements. I use it for things like thermostats, speakers, security systems, and some lighting setups, but I always confirm compatibility before installation.

Strand Quality and Flexibility

One thing I notice right away is how well the wire feels when I handle it. A good stranded wire should be flexible but still sturdy. I prefer wire with fine, evenly twisted strands because it is easier for me to strip, terminate, and route without damage. Poor-quality wire can fray or break more easily, which slows me down.

Color Coding Helps Me Stay Organized

I like wire that has clearly marked or distinct conductor colors. It makes my work cleaner and reduces the chance of mistakes when I am connecting devices. If the wire is not color-coded clearly, I find it harder to keep track of polarity and connections, especially in longer runs.

Indoor vs. Outdoor Use

I always ask myself where the wire will be used. For indoor projects, standard 18 2 stranded wire is usually fine. For outdoor use, I look for weather-resistant jackets and proper ratings. I have learned that using the wrong type of wire outdoors can lead to faster wear, safety issues, and project failure.
